When the wind speed (frequency of the wind sensor pulse signal W) rises above the set threshold level, the local OPEN (A) and 

CLOSE (Z) inputs are completely blocked. The light sensor (S) also has no effect on the controller under this condition. The 

inputs are enabled again after the wind speed drops below the set threshold level.

The SMS 2 dynamically adjusts the response delay for wind „t

on

“ (that means the higher the wind speed overstepping, the 

shorter the response time).
